The Center for Strategic Communications and Information Security (CSK) is urging people not to panic over reports in foreign media about a “major offensive” that Russia is allegedly preparing. This was stated in a message from the Center on Facebook.
“The media is writing about Russia’s plans for a new” major offensive. But there’s no need to panic because of these articles, and here’s why,” the message said.
It was noted that the Financial Times published material that the Russian army may be planning a large-scale offensive in Ukraine this summer. The goal is the complete capture of Donetsk, Lugansk, Kherson and Zaporozhye regions.
“A separate highlight is the part of the article that says the Kremlin does not rule out another attempt to occupy Kharkov or Kiev. It looks, of course, scary and panics. But in essence, the journalists said nothing new . Obviously, Putin has not abandoned the idea of capturing all of Ukraine and continues to throw all available resources to the front,” the Center for Strategic Communications emphasized.
But, as mentioned, this does not mean that the Kremlin’s plans will come true.
“After all, the Armed Forces of Ukraine continue to hold the defense, and Kiev is reliably protected. The invaders did not reach the capital at the beginning of 2022, when the Ukrainian army was weak and poorly armed, so now they can’t come. You can do it, even more. Instead of panicking and overthinking, help the Defense Forces: donate, volunteer, spread important and verified information, ” said the center.
Let’s recall that the day before the British newspaper Financial Times, citing sources, reported that Russia may be planning a major frontal offensive in Ukraine in the summer of 2024.
Also this week, Putin threatened an “irreversible blow” for Ukraine. He made it clear that the longer the war goes on, the less territory the Ukrainian authorities will be able to control.
